A Short Term Lease Apartments in Borgue is a legal contract that indicates that a lessee will give services or monetary damages to a lessor in exchange for temporary possession (not ownership) of property. Individuals and firms may use short-term leases for virtually any property. Generally, a short term lease lasts less than a year (normally one month to six months), but some industries may define short-term leases as lasting two or three years.

As with standard monthly leases, all details regarding additional fees and deposits must be included in the lease. For vacation rentals, common added charges may appear from cleaning fees and resort taxes. Additional costs may also be incurred at the property for pets or other people, remains beyond the checkout time, property damage and phone use. Reservation deposit or a damage deposit is a lease demand to hold the property. Terms for the return of a damage deposit should be spelled out clearly. Complete payment for the vacation rental is required before the arrival date--sometimes up to 30 days before check-in.

Be careful not to price yourself out of the marketplace when you establish the rent for your furnished apartment. If you set the rent too high, you may be unable to rent the apartment to anyone. If you are concerned about your furnishings, you might be better off to sell or keep them and rent the apartment unfurnished. Generally speaking, you should establish the rent based on your expenses to own and maintain the property, including the furnishings, plus your desired rate of return on your investment. For example, if it costs you $15,000 per year to possess and preserve the property, and you desire to make $5,000 per year on the property, the yearly rent should be $20,000, or month. about $1,675 per Compare that price to other rents in the region, taking into account the characteristics and furnishings of your property, and charge rent that'll fulfill your needs still be competitive.

To protect your investment when renting a furnished flat, it's wise to supply the tenant with an itemized list of the things included in the apartment rental. Be very specific; list the number of plates, bowls, and cups, as an example, and describe items as accurately as possible. List the replacement cost of each item if it is damaged beyond ordinary wear and tear, or if the piece is taken by the tenant with him when he moves out. Indicate if the replacement cost will be required out of the security deposit, or if the tenant will need to pay you for the items. Have so there aren't any surprises when the rental comes to a finish the tenant sign a copy of this inventory.

If you lease a home or apartment that is furnished, whether it contains only some basic furniture or is fully furnished with furniture, linens, electronics, and accessories, you can charge tenants rent that is higher. You'd to purchase the items that are furnishing the house, and will need to replace those things if they are damaged or destroyed. Those costs will be recouped by a monthly rent that is higher. It's up to you as the landlord to decide how much more you need to charge for the furnishings, but typically owners will base the increased price on the condition and style of the furnishings. For instance, a property that includes a brand new, modern living room set is worth more than one that includes pieces that are mismatched with frayed seams.

In addition to or instead of a higher rent for a furnished flat, you could request a higher security deposit on the lease. Collecting more money up front can help you cover the costs of repairing or replacing the things in the furnished flat if they can be damaged. Check with your state laws before collecting the security deposit, however. Some states have laws controlling security deposits and what landlords can charge. If you do not want to include it in the security deposit, you could also charge a separate cleaning fee for the lease, to pay for the costs of cleaning curtains, bedding, furniture and other things.

Any service that incurs a fee should be comprised in the lease, including mobile usage, garbage, laundry, housekeeping, and parking. Occasionally, optional services are available, like housekeeping services along with cleaning upon departure. These should be, at the absolute minimum, recorded on the lease in case the vacationers choose to use the service after they arrive. Expectations about the utilization of the property should also be clearly indicated--either in the lease or via a procedures guide referenced in the contract. Who cleans the grill? Who takes out the garbage and where does it go? Should the vacationers or by housekeeping strip the sheets? Must the dishes be washed before housekeeping arrives? These are all problems that should be addressed to ensure a smooth vacation and avert battles over the lease and the stay.

Whether you desire to hire one or own a vacation rental, it's important to protect yourself with a contract that clearly lays out the responsibilities and duties of all parties.

The dates and times of departure and arrival are spelled out in great specificity in the vacation rental lease. Vacationers are coming and going every week--sometimes every few days--and the units must be cleaned between stays. To avert vacancy between stays, the time between check in and checkout is typically a relatively short window. And because some vacationers rely on air transportation, there are occasionally last minute requests to arrive or depart early or late. It is, therefore, crucial that you include contingency requests in the lease, signifying both a cost and a process to change agreed upon strategies.
